Re: Untamed Virus Containment Thread: COVID-19: Ride the Wave, Dude! Edition
« Reply #3425 on: June 28, 2020, 04:58:56 pm »

Eh, new cases is a sensational but not terribly helpful statistic.  You need more information - what is the positive rate? Is this serological, PCR, or diagnostic? Is this new "active" cases or is this "probably had it two months ago and was never/mildly symptomatic"?

The more important numbers are new deaths per day and ICU usage.  We will have to, unfortunately, wait about 7 more days before we see if the rumors of weakening are true, or if we will see the uptick in daily deaths; the recent increases in daily case counts started about 7 days ago so the "real" impacts are still a ways off.

Re: Untamed Virus Containment Thread: COVID-19: Ride the Wave, Dude! Edition
« Reply #3432 on: June 28, 2020, 10:04:36 pm »

As I pointed out a few pages ago, you have to account for increases in testing. California's been stable in percent positive tests for around 3 months, staying around 5%.

Texas is trending upwards, increasing from 7% to 14% over the last two weeks. Florida's had a huge spike, going from 5% to 15%.

California’s curve has been sloping upward fairly gently, so not surprised it could be due to testing. Thanks for that. There could also be a confounding effect there where more people getting the virus lead to more contact tracing bringing in negative results, which would deflate the positive rate despite a real increase in infections. We’d also need more data on California’s testing regime to come to any form conclusions there. The curve is beautifully exponential, which leads me to suspect the increase in daily cases is real, though possibly overstated.

 The Texas/Florida data also makes sense given the numbers I am seeing. I should probably stress that I am a physicist by trade, so have a good deal of experience with numerical modelling, so to me at least it seems obvious that the sudden inflection point in Florida’s data and shift to rapid exponential growth could only really be explained by a large outbreak. For people who haven’t studied differential equations my current musings probably sound like numerology.
